Melbourne Umpiring Course report – Report by Gerard Kelly IL Shim Sunshine Coast

On the eve of the first IL Shim Victorian Challenge an umpire course was held to continue IL Shims dedication to educating members on correct umpiring procedures and techniques. This first season of seminars was mainly about the basics as most participants had never refereed at all, so we started at the very beginning. For the moment specific rules are not thoroughly covered as we need to know what to say and how to say it, before we really get into why you should be saying it.

Terminology was once again covered as this is so important to becoming a proficient umpire. Signals were also covered as again this is essential to being understood by all competitors. After the theory component was completed, the practical session was introduced. In this part we got every participant to go though the process of stopping the fight, giving the warning, and starting the bout in the most efficient manner.

Once everyone got over their nerves, they started to enjoy themselves and got used to the system.
